Freefall at Flyaway Indoor Skydiving

By Article Expert on May. 28, 2009.

As more individuals have become interested in indoor skydiving experiences, there have been more and more indoor skydiving gyms that have been springing up all over the country.  There are even some indoor skydiving chains, such as Flyaway, that have wind tunnels all over the country.  Many of these gyms are used by professional skydivers such as military personnel and other expert skydivers.  The reason that they will choose Flyaway indoor skydiving gyms for practice rather than practicing from the airplane at all times is because they can get more flight experience in the free fall stages for less cost than jumping from an airplane.  This allows these personnel to become more proficient and safer in the air so that there are less accidents and injuries due to errors during free fall.

Conditions

There are certain requirements that must be met if individuals want to participate at a Flyaway indoor skydiving tunnel.  One is that individuals cannot weigh more than two hundred thirty pounds and cannot weight less than forty.  The reason for this is that it is impossible for those outside of those limits to either achieve lift, or to achieve lift in a safe manner, being able to maneuver in the wind tunnel rather than being blown around in it.

Every Flyaway indoor skydiving tunnel requires individuals to go through a training class so that they can learn the basics of skydiving indoors.  In addition, they will be giving a short lesson with an instructor on flying, where the instructor spots the individuals while they take their first flights.  Before going into the tunnel, individuals will be given a flight suit, helmet, ear plugs and goggles so that all safety equipment and requirements are met.  Otherwise, individuals should wear comfortable clothing that they are able to fully move around in during flight.  In addition, socks and tennis shoes are required for safety reasons so that landings are safe.

The Flyaway indoor skydiving tunnels are beneficial to training both experts and novices, requiring each to learn how to maneuver in a tight environment, thus sharpening the skills of all who participate.  This means that a person that is used to maneuvering in a traditional skydiving free fall may have trouble at first in a tunnel experience since they do not have a lot of room to maneuver.  However, this will ultimately help them to sharpen their skills in the open air since, if they are able to do turns and dives in a small environment, they will be that much more precise in the open sky, thus decreasing the chances for mistakes and giving the enthusiast the ultimate extreme skydiving adventure.

Hi Ho Off You Go- Indoor Skydiving Las Vegas

By Article Expert on May. 2, 2009.

Flyaway indoor skydiving and indoor skydiving is more prevelant since the early 80’s due to its popularity.   There have been more wind tunnels constructed around the country in major cities, especially those cities that are known for their entertainment qualities. In addition to everyday vacationers, Celebrities seeking a form of escape often times try indoor skydiving Las Vegas for the extreme experience. Besides being more cost effective, indoor skydiving is a much safer way to experience the thrill of skydiving.  

Training

Training classes are required when going to an indoor skydiving tunnel in in Las Vegas for the first time. This is to make the person aware of basic saftey procedures and flying techniques as to avoid injury.   Many of the best indoor skydiving tunnels in Las Vegas will offer these classes on a repeating basis throughout the day so that individuals can come at any time and get into a class within the half hour of their arrival. You will be able to take your first flight after the class is completed. Individuals will be able to take the plunge and practice once they have the basic techniques down.

For those who are interested in not only indoor skydiving in Las Vegas, but also experiencing skydiving from an airplane, indoor skydiving is a great first step. Since the velocity of the wind tunnel air is normally around 120 miles/hr a person can indulge in free falling techniques to prepare for an airplane jump. Many experts use indoor skydiving as a means to practice and gain more air time thereby reducing the cost you would norally have in renting an airplane.

Las Vegas indoor skydiving has a weight limitation of 40lbs if you have an interest in trying the sport. For saftey reasons children will need to be accommpanied by their parents in order to participate. Since there is such a low chance of injury, and because it is a relatively low impact sport, any age can enjoy the thrill and experince of indoor skydiving. Las Vegas tunnels have certain restrictions for air flight. To qualify for indoor skydiving an individual must meet certain weight to height ratios. If you are a man you cannot weigh more than 180lbs if your are under 5′ 6″. For a women the weight limitation is 160lbs and the height is 5′ 6″.

Paintball Sniper Gear: an in depth look

By Article Expert on May. 1, 2009.

There are many things that can assist you as a paintball player especially if you want to be a paintball sniper. Many of these things include pod carriers, camouflage, a silencer, and a scope. These are excellent accessories to the game.

A silencer is the best thing you might want to add to your sniper rifle. This will let you take shots silently. This helps when trying to keep quiet when surrounded by the enemy. The silencer allows you to take a shot quietly. Some guns are very loud when they shoot. You don’t want this. As a sniper you have to be as quiet as possible. That means with your movements as you crawl, when you talk to your teammates through radios, and when you shoot your gun.

Pod carriers allow you to carry extra ammunition on you while you are playing the game. Attach these to your vest and or belt. You don’t want to lose your ammo or find that you left it at the last location you were hiding before. Perhaps the most deadly mistake is running out of ammunition. Pod carriers are the best solution.

Camouflage is important because you don’t want to be seen when you are playing. When playing in the dark you don’. Many people like to wear black. Some people like to wear outfits that have leaves and things integrated in them so they look like the ground until they stand up and begin firing; these are called ghillie suits. The goal is to blend in with the environment you are playing in. You don’t want to stick out like a sore thumb because you will be out of the game within a few minutes of play.

A scope and a red dot laser are important to many snipers also. Some people don’t think about this until they get out on the playing field and they have a disadvantage because they cannot get their target in the right line of sight. They may continue to miss their target. A red dot laser allows you to have your shot in place before you pull the trigger. The scope is the sniper’s best friend, it gives a huge advantage. These two accessories are very important and can help you become an amazing sniper out in the field.

When you are a paintball sniper there are many considerations to being a good sniper. These things include carrying extra ammunition, blending in with the environment with your clothing, and using a silencer on your gun. These few things can help you tremendously last for a very long time out on the field when you are playing paintball. Be sure to be as quiet as you can when you are shooting and talking to your teammates too. A paintball sniper is a sneaky player that has an excellent aim for their target.
